CVE-2026-7270
7.8
C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H
Summary
An operator precedence bug in the kernel results in a scenario where a buffer overflow causes attacker-controlled data to overwrite adjacent execve(2) argument buffers.
The bug may be exploitable by an unprivileged user to obtain superuser privileges.
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| FreeBSD | FreeBSD | 15.0-RELEASE < p7 | affected |
| FreeBSD | FreeBSD | 14.4-RELEASE < p3 | affected |
| FreeBSD | FreeBSD | 14.3-RELEASE < p12 | affected |
| FreeBSD | FreeBSD | 13.5-RELEASE < p13 | affected |
Weaknesses
- CWE-783: CWE-783: Operator Precedence Logic Error
